The Cross Bearers, WW1 battlefield by Matania
British soldiers on a devastated battlefield rescuing a figure of Jesus Christ and his cross from a ruined church. Date: 1918

This poignant image, titled "The Cross Bearers," captures a poignant moment during the final stages of World War I. Depicting the devastated battlefield of the Western Front in 1918, British soldiers are seen carefully carrying a figure of Jesus Christ and his cross from the ruins of a destroyed church. The haunting scene serves as a powerful reminder of the human cost of war and the enduring power of faith. The painting, created by renowned British war artist Fortunino Matania, masterfully conveys the desolation and destruction wrought by the conflict. The soldiers, weary from battle, move with reverence and care as they protect the sacred effigy from the ravages of war. The juxtaposition of the religious icon amidst the chaos of the battlefield underscores the resilience of the human spirit and the importance of hope amidst the horrors of war.
